@font-face{font-family:IBM Plex Mono;font-style:normal;font-weight:400;font-display:swap;src:url(/fonts/IBMPlexMono-Regular.woff2) format("woff2")}@font-face{font-family:IBM Plex Mono;font-style:normal;font-weight:500;font-display:swap;src:url(/fonts/IBMPlexMono-Medium.woff2) format("woff2")}@font-face{font-family:IBM Plex Mono;font-style:normal;font-weight:600;font-display:swap;src:url(/fonts/IBMPlexMono-SemiBold.woff2) format("woff2")}@font-face{font-family:IBM Plex Sans Condensed;font-style:normal;font-weight:500;font-display:swap;src:url(/fonts/IBMPlexSansCondensed-Medium.woff2) format("woff2")}@font-face{font-family:IBM Plex Sans Condensed;font-style:normal;font-weight:600;font-display:swap;src:url(/fonts/IBMPlexSansCondensed-SemiBold.woff2) format("woff2")}@font-face{font-family:IBM Plex Sans Condensed;font-style:normal;font-weight:700;font-display:swap;src:url(/fonts/IBMPlexSansCondensed-Bold.woff2) format("woff2")}html,body{margin:0;padding:0;background:#0a0a0a;color-scheme:dark}.tg *{box-sizing:border-box;margin:0;padding:0}.tg{--bg: #0a0a0a;--panel: #111214;--panel2: #16181b;--line: #262a2e;--ink: #f2f1ef;--mute: #8b9094;--faint: #54595e;--red: #fa114e;--jade: #25cc8f;--amber: #f2b11a;--sky: #2ba1e8;--mono: "IBM Plex Mono", ui-monospace, monospace;--cond: "IBM Plex Sans Condensed", system-ui, sans-serif;background:var(--bg);color:var(--ink);font-family:var(--mono);min-height:100vh;line-height:1.5;-webkit-font-smoothing:antialiased;position:relative;overflow-x:hidden}.tg:before{content:"";position:fixed;top:0;right:0;bottom:0;left:0;z-index:0;pointer-events:none;opacity:.04;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='140' height='140'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='.85' numOctaves='3'/%3E%3C/filter%3E%3Crect width='100%25' height='100%25' filter='url(%23n)'/%3E%3C/svg%3E")}.tg:after{content:"";position:fixed;top:-30%;left:50%;width:900px;height:900px;transform:translate(-50%);z-index:0;pointer-events:none;background:radial-gradient(circle,rgba(250,17,78,.1),transparent 60%);filter:blur(20px)}.wrap{max-width:1080px;margin:0 auto;padding:0 28px;position:relative;z-index:1}.tg a{color:inherit;text-decoration:none}.sr-only{position:absolute;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.tg a:focus-visible,.tg button:focus-visible,.tg input:focus-visible{outline:2px solid var(--red);outline-offset:3px;border-radius:2px}.top{display:flex;justify-content:space-between;align-items:center;padding:24px 0}.mark{font-family:var(--mono);font-weight:600;font-size:13px;letter-spacing:.05em;display:flex;align-items:center;gap:9px}.led{width:7px;height:7px;border-radius:50%;background:var(--red);box-shadow:0 0 10px var(--red);animation:blink 2.4s steps(1) infinite}@keyframes blink{0%,70%{opacity:1}71%,to{opacity:.25}}.nav{display:flex;gap:26px;font-size:12px;color:var(--mute);letter-spacing:.03em}.nav a:hover{color:var(--ink)}.hero{display:grid;grid-template-columns:1.05fr .95fr;gap:36px;align-items:center;padding:54px 0 30px;position:relative}.ghostword{position:absolute;top:-40px;left:-14px;font-family:var(--cond);font-weight:700;font-size:230px;letter-spacing:-.04em;color:#fff;opacity:.025;pointer-events:none;line-height:1;text-transform:uppercase;z-index:0}.heroL{position:relative;z-index:1}.kick{font-family:var(--mono);font-size:11px;letter-spacing:.2em;text-transform:uppercase;color:var(--faint);display:flex;align-items:center;gap:10px;margin-bottom:26px}.kick b{color:var(--red);font-weight:500}.kick .bar{flex:0 0 34px;height:1px;background:var(--line)}h1{font-family:var(--cond);font-weight:700;font-size:clamp(46px,7vw,86px);line-height:.92;letter-spacing:-.02em;text-transform:uppercase}h1 .thin{color:var(--mute);font-weight:500;display:block}h1 .red{color:var(--red)}.lede{max-width:430px;margin-top:26px;color:var(--mute);font-size:14px;line-height:1.75}.cta{display:flex;flex-wrap:wrap;gap:13px;margin-top:34px}.btn{font-family:var(--mono);font-size:12.5px;letter-spacing:.04em;padding:14px 22px;border:1px solid var(--line);display:inline-flex;align-items:center;gap:10px;transition:.18s ease;background:transparent}.btn .ar{color:var(--faint);transition:.18s ease}.btn.primary{background:var(--red);border-color:var(--red);color:#fff;font-weight:500;box-shadow:0 8px 30px #fa114e40}.btn.primary .ar{color:#ffffffbf}.btn.primary:hover{filter:brightness(1.1);transform:translateY(-1px)}.btn.primary:hover .ar{transform:translate(3px)}.btn.ghost:hover{border-color:var(--ink);background:var(--panel)}.btn.ghost:hover .ar{color:var(--ink);transform:translate(3px)}.heroR{display:flex;justify-content:center;position:relative;z-index:1}.phone{width:286px;height:586px;border-radius:46px;background:linear-gradient(160deg,#1c1f23,#0c0d0f);padding:11px;box-shadow:0 40px 90px #0009,0 0 0 1px #ffffff0a,inset 0 0 0 1px #ffffff0d;position:relative}.phone:after{content:"";position:absolute;left:50%;top:11px;transform:translate(-50%);width:104px;height:26px;background:#000;border-radius:0 0 16px 16px;z-index:5}.screen{width:100%;height:100%;border-radius:36px;background:#070708;overflow:hidden;position:relative;display:flex;flex-direction:column}.scr-glow{position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(120% 60% at 50% 0%,rgba(250,17,78,.14),transparent 55%);pointer-events:none}.sbar{display:flex;justify-content:space-between;align-items:center;padding:14px 22px 4px;font-size:11px;font-weight:600;color:var(--ink)}.sbar .dots{display:flex;gap:3px;align-items:center}.sbar .dots i{width:3px;height:8px;background:var(--ink);border-radius:1px;display:inline-block}.sbar .bat{width:20px;height:10px;border:1px solid var(--ink);border-radius:2px;position:relative;opacity:.9}.sbar .bat:after{content:"";position:absolute;left:1.5px;top:1.5px;bottom:1.5px;width:11px;background:var(--jade);border-radius:1px}.scr-body{padding:8px 18px 0;flex:1;display:flex;flex-direction:column;gap:12px}.scr-title{font-family:var(--cond);font-weight:700;font-size:30px;letter-spacing:-.01em;margin-top:2px}.streak{border:1px solid var(--line);border-radius:18px;background:linear-gradient(180deg,#141213,#0c0a0b);padding:16px 18px;position:relative;overflow:hidden}.streak:before{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:var(--red)}.streak .l{font-family:var(--mono);font-size:9px;letter-spacing:.18em;color:var(--faint);text-transform:uppercase}.streak .big{font-family:var(--cond);font-weight:700;font-size:62px;line-height:.9;letter-spacing:-.02em;margin-top:4px}.streak .big small{font-size:15px;color:var(--mute);margin-left:6px;letter-spacing:.04em}.streak .wks{display:flex;gap:5px;margin-top:12px}.streak .wks i{flex:1;height:5px;border-radius:3px;background:#2a1118}.streak .wks i.on{background:var(--red)}.ideaL{font-family:var(--mono);font-size:9px;letter-spacing:.18em;color:var(--faint);text-transform:uppercase;margin-top:2px}.idea{border:1px solid var(--line);border-radius:14px;background:var(--panel);padding:12px 13px;display:flex;gap:11px;align-items:flex-start}.chip{flex:0 0 auto;width:30px;height:30px;border-radius:9px;display:flex;align-items:center;justify-content:center;font-family:var(--cond);font-weight:700;font-size:14px}.chip.hi{background:var(--red);color:#fff}.chip.mid{background:#1c1f23;color:var(--amber);border:1px solid var(--line)}.idea p{font-size:11px;line-height:1.4;color:var(--ink)}.idea p span{color:var(--faint)}.tabbar{margin-top:auto;display:flex;justify-content:space-around;padding:12px 10px 18px;border-top:1px solid var(--line);background:#0a0a0b}.tab{display:flex;flex-direction:column;align-items:center;gap:5px;font-size:8.5px;letter-spacing:.06em;color:var(--faint);text-transform:uppercase}.tab.on{color:var(--red)}.tab .ic{width:18px;height:18px;border-radius:5px;border:1.6px solid currentColor;opacity:.85}.tab.on .ic{background:#fa114e26}.recdot{width:6px;height:6px;border-radius:50%;background:var(--red);box-shadow:0 0 8px var(--red);animation:blink 1.4s steps(1) infinite;align-self:center}.proof{display:grid;grid-template-columns:repeat(4,1fr);border:1px solid var(--line);margin-top:30px;background:var(--panel)}.proof .cell{padding:24px 20px;border-right:1px solid var(--line)}.proof .cell:last-child{border-right:none}.proof .n{font-family:var(--cond);font-weight:700;font-size:clamp(26px,4vw,38px);letter-spacing:-.01em;display:flex;align-items:baseline;gap:2px}.proof .n .u{color:var(--red);font-size:.6em}.proof .lab{font-size:9.5px;letter-spacing:.16em;text-transform:uppercase;color:var(--faint);margin-top:7px}.proof .stat{display:flex;align-items:center;gap:8px}.proof .stat .d{width:7px;height:7px;border-radius:50%;background:var(--jade);box-shadow:0 0 8px var(--jade)}section{padding:64px 0}.ey{font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:var(--faint);margin-bottom:24px;display:flex;align-items:center;gap:10px}.ey .i{color:var(--red)}.ey .bar{flex:1;height:1px;background:var(--line)}.flag{border:1px solid var(--line);background:linear-gradient(115deg,var(--panel2),#0c0d0f);padding:38px;display:grid;grid-template-columns:1fr auto;gap:30px;align-items:center;position:relative;overflow:hidden}.flag:before{content:"";position:absolute;left:0;top:0;bottom:0;width:3px;background:var(--red)}.flag:after{content:"";position:absolute;right:-80px;top:-80px;width:260px;height:260px;background:radial-gradient(circle,rgba(250,17,78,.14),transparent 60%);pointer-events:none}.flag .tg-tag{font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:var(--red);margin-bottom:14px;display:flex;align-items:center;gap:10px}.soon{display:inline-flex;align-items:center;gap:6px;font-size:9px;letter-spacing:.14em;color:var(--amber);border:1px solid rgba(242,177,26,.4);padding:3px 9px;border-radius:20px}.soon .d{width:5px;height:5px;border-radius:50%;background:var(--amber);box-shadow:0 0 7px var(--amber)}.flag h2{font-family:var(--cond);font-weight:700;font-size:clamp(32px,5vw,50px);line-height:1;letter-spacing:-.01em;text-transform:uppercase}.flag .sub{color:var(--mute);font-size:14px;margin-top:14px;max-width:430px;line-height:1.7}.flag .row{display:flex;flex-wrap:wrap;gap:12px;margin-top:24px}.flag .meta{margin-top:22px;font-size:10px;letter-spacing:.05em;color:var(--faint);display:flex;gap:16px;flex-wrap:wrap}.flag .meta span{display:flex;align-items:center;gap:7px}.flag .meta .d{width:6px;height:6px;border-radius:50%;background:var(--jade)}.wait{margin-top:22px;max-width:430px}.wlab{font-size:10px;letter-spacing:.16em;text-transform:uppercase;color:var(--faint);margin-bottom:10px}.wform{display:flex;border:1px solid var(--line);background:#0c0d0f;transition:.18s ease}.wform:focus-within{border-color:var(--red);box-shadow:0 0 0 3px #fa114e1f}.wform input{flex:1;background:transparent;border:none;outline:none;color:var(--ink);font-family:var(--mono);font-size:13px;padding:14px 15px;letter-spacing:.02em}.wform input::placeholder{color:var(--faint)}.wform button{background:var(--red);border:none;color:#fff;font-family:var(--mono);font-size:12.5px;font-weight:500;letter-spacing:.04em;padding:0 22px;cursor:pointer;display:flex;align-items:center;gap:8px;transition:.18s ease}.wform button:hover{filter:brightness(1.12)}.wform button:disabled{opacity:.6;cursor:default;filter:none}.werr{color:var(--red);font-size:11px;margin-top:9px;letter-spacing:.02em;min-height:15px}.wdone{display:flex;align-items:center;gap:11px;border:1px solid rgba(37,204,143,.4);background:#25cc8f12;padding:14px 16px;font-size:13px;line-height:1.4;color:var(--ink)}.wdone .ck{color:var(--jade);font-weight:600;flex:0 0 auto}.flag .badge{flex:0 0 auto}.flag .badge .ico{width:104px;height:104px;border-radius:24px;background:linear-gradient(160deg,#1a1416,#0a0809);border:1px solid var(--line);display:flex;align-items:center;justify-content:center;position:relative;box-shadow:0 20px 50px #00000080}.flag .badge .ico .cd-stack{display:flex;flex-direction:column;gap:5px}.flag .badge .ico .cd-stack i{width:46px;height:10px;border-radius:3px;background:var(--line)}.flag .badge .ico .cd-stack i:nth-child(1){width:54px;background:var(--red)}.flag .badge .ico .cd-stack i:nth-child(2){width:40px}.grid{display:grid;grid-template-columns:repeat(3,1fr);gap:14px}.mod{border:1px solid var(--line);background:var(--panel);padding:22px;display:flex;flex-direction:column;gap:13px;transition:.2s ease;position:relative;overflow:hidden;min-height:178px}.mod .top-line{position:absolute;left:0;top:0;height:2px;width:100%;opacity:0;transition:.2s ease}.mod:hover{transform:translateY(-3px);border-color:#363c41;background:var(--panel2)}.mod:hover .top-line{opacity:1}.mod .idx{font-size:10px;color:var(--faint);letter-spacing:.1em}.mod .head{display:flex;align-items:center;gap:13px}.ico{width:46px;height:46px;border-radius:12px;flex:0 0 auto;position:relative;overflow:hidden;border:1px solid rgba(255,255,255,.06)}.ico-sober{background:#e9e7e2;display:grid;grid-template-columns:repeat(3,1fr);grid-template-rows:repeat(3,1fr);gap:2.5px;padding:8px}.ico-sober i{background:#1a1a1a;border-radius:1.5px}.ico-sober i:nth-child(9){background:var(--jade)}.ico-confess{background:radial-gradient(circle at 50% 50%,#000 38%,#ffffffd9 41%,#ffffff1a 52%,#050505 70%)}.ico-mind{background:#0c0c12}.ico-mind:after{content:"";position:absolute;top:11px;right:11px;bottom:11px;left:11px;border-radius:50%;background:radial-gradient(circle at 35% 30%,#ff4fd8,#7a3cff 45%,#2ba1e8 95%);box-shadow:0 0 14px #783cff99}.ico-kid{background:#0a1410;display:flex;align-items:center;justify-content:center}.ico-kid:after{content:"";width:24px;height:24px;border-radius:50%;border:3px solid var(--jade);border-right-color:transparent;transform:rotate(45deg);box-shadow:0 0 12px #25cc8f80}.ico-nex{background:#0b0b0b;position:relative}.ico-nex: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:repeating-linear-gradient(125deg,transparent 0 6px,var(--amber) 6px 9px)}.ico-sweep{background:linear-gradient(160deg,#2ba1e8,#1d6fb0);display:flex;align-items:center;justify-content:center}.ico-sweep:after{content:"";width:22px;height:18px;background:var(--jade);border-radius:2px 4px 4px;box-shadow:-6px 3px 0 -1px #1d6fb0,3px -4px #ffffff40}img.ico{object-fit:cover;display:block}.mod h3{font-family:var(--cond);font-weight:600;font-size:21px;letter-spacing:.01em}.mod p{font-size:12px;color:var(--mute);line-height:1.55}.mod .foot{margin-top:auto;font-size:9.5px;letter-spacing:.14em;text-transform:uppercase;color:var(--faint);display:flex;align-items:center;gap:8px;padding-top:8px}.mod .foot .chk{color:var(--jade)}.thesis{border-top:1px solid var(--line)}.thesis p{font-family:var(--cond);font-weight:500;font-size:clamp(22px,3.4vw,32px);line-height:1.34;letter-spacing:-.01em;max-width:820px}.thesis .dim{color:var(--faint)}.follow{display:grid;grid-template-columns:1fr 1fr;gap:14px}.fcard{border:1px solid var(--line);background:var(--panel);padding:30px;display:flex;justify-content:space-between;align-items:flex-end;transition:.2s ease;position:relative;overflow:hidden}.fcard:hover{transform:translateY(-3px);border-color:#363c41;background:var(--panel2)}.fcard .net{font-family:var(--cond);font-weight:700;font-size:25px;text-transform:uppercase}.fcard .h{font-size:11px;color:var(--mute);margin-top:3px}.fcard .c{text-align:right}.fcard .c .n{font-family:var(--cond);font-weight:700;font-size:32px;letter-spacing:-.01em}.fcard .c .n .u{color:var(--red);font-size:.6em}.fcard .c .l{font-size:9.5px;letter-spacing:.16em;text-transform:uppercase;color:var(--faint)}footer{border-top:1px solid var(--line);padding:40px 0 56px;color:var(--faint);font-size:12px}.frow{display:flex;justify-content:space-between;flex-wrap:wrap;gap:14px;align-items:center}footer a:hover{color:var(--ink)}.mail{color:var(--mute)}.rise{opacity:0;transform:translateY(16px);animation:rise .7s cubic-bezier(.2,.7,.2,1) forwards}@keyframes rise{to{opacity:1;transform:none}}@media(max-width:860px){.hero{grid-template-columns:1fr;gap:46px}.heroR{order:2}.ghostword{font-size:150px;top:-20px}.proof{grid-template-columns:repeat(2,1fr)}.proof .cell:nth-child(2){border-right:none}.proof .cell:nth-child(1),.proof .cell:nth-child(2){border-bottom:1px solid var(--line)}.grid{grid-template-columns:1fr 1fr}.flag{grid-template-columns:1fr}.flag .badge{order:-1}}@media(max-width:560px){.grid,.follow{grid-template-columns:1fr}.nav a:not(.keep){display:none}}@media(prefers-reduced-motion:reduce){.tg *,.tg *:before,.tg *:after{animation-duration:.001ms!important;animation-iteration-count:1!important;transition-duration:.001ms!important}.rise{opacity:1!important;transform:none!important;animation:none!important}.btn.primary:hover,.btn.primary:hover .ar,.btn.ghost:hover .ar,.mod:hover,.fcard:hover{transform:none!important}}
